How to find out the amount of freon in the air conditioner

The standard split system is two modules: external and internal. Between them, a freon route is laid from copper tubes filled with refrigerant. The volume of freon in the air conditioner depends on the power of the compressor and the length of the cold track, so no specialist can name the exact number.

In the factory, the equipment is charged with refrigerant based on the route length from 3 to 5 meters, so the route needs to be laid at least 3 meters, if it is longer than 5, the unit should be refueled. On average, about 15 grams of freon per meter of track. The manufacturer notifies you how much freon is in the air conditioner using the information table located on the case. In the weakest models it can be 90 grams, in powerful split systems up to 600 grams.

The amount of freon in the air conditioner may decrease, as the refrigerant evaporates through the leaky fastenings of the route. The filling of the route is carried out only after installation and evacuation of the system. This procedure is carried out by specialists, since it requires special skills and the availability of equipment.

The volume of freon in window-type air conditioners is constant. The track is filled with refrigerant at the factory and sealed there sealed. Refueling is necessary only after compressor repair.

The amount of freon for refueling

The exact amount of refrigerant is important for the correct and safe operation of the device. If there is insufficient or excessive amount of freon in the system, critical conditions occur under which compressor damage is possible. An excess of freon is more fatal for the air conditioner than its drawback: the system was charged and everything should work well, but the device stops turning on. When checking, it turns out that the compressor is damaged by water hammer due to improper refueling and needs to be replaced.

Signs of excess Freon:

  • Excess refrigerant in the air conditioner reduces the performance of the device. If after refueling the split system does not work well, it is turned off and another master is invited - from a specialized service.
  • The pressure in the evaporator is increased, because Freon cannot completely get into it, and half of the substance is in the condenser.
  • The gas entering the condenser is not cooled sufficiently, which increases the pressure in the condenser.

The compressor fails for two reasons:

  • Due to damage to the electric motor of the compressor at high current, which increases with increasing condensation pressure.
  • Due to water hammer, when excess refrigerant enters the compressor.

Determine the amount of freon by looking at the manufacturer's instructions and recommendations. Some types of refrigerants have a higher pressure during operation, so they charge less material.In this, non-professional masters are most often mistaken, therefore it is better to deal with specialists who have extensive experience.

How to find out about an insufficient amount of freon

If the volume of refueling the air conditioner has decreased, this is noticeable by the following signs:

  • frost forms on the indoor unit;
  • traces of ice are present on the outdoor unit;
  • there are traces of oil on the pipes;
  • the performance of the device is noticeably reduced - with the settings, some indicators, on the thermometer in the apartment - others.
Hoarfrost in the indoor unit indicates a lack of freon

Freon leakage occurs for several reasons. The air conditioner vibrates during operation, and the vibrations create the conditions for the divergence of welds on copper pipes. If the tubes themselves are poorly sealed during installation, cracks form.

It is most difficult to identify the place of leakage, especially if the highway is laid in gates and covered with a layer of plaster. If the length of the trunk is small, and the indoor and outdoor units are located nearby, it will be easier for the wizard to disassemble the system and troubleshoot. For such work, it is advisable to immediately call the repair team, since it is difficult to diagnose and refuel without special equipment - there is a risk of completely disabling the equipment.

At the first sign of icing, the air conditioner is turned off and the craftsmen called.

Before the arrival of the master, it is advisable to clean the indoor unit from dust and dirt, because the decrease in the system’s work is due to the sticking of a layer of dust and grease on the strainer, as a result of which the air flow is not sufficiently effectively sucked in.

Before starting the test with a manometric manifold, a specialist will clean the external unit and only after cleaning will it check if there is a freon leak in the air conditioner.
